UNIQLO T-shirt Grand Prix 2019

As announced a few days ago, the UNIQLO T-shirt Grand Prix 2019 went live today. This year, the theme is Pokémon, and fans can submit their entries until December 2nd. There’s no less than $10 000 to win: that’s what the winner of the Grand Prize will receive! The winners will be announced in Summer 2019.

Here’s the prizes:

  • Grand Prize: $10 000 + invite to the award ceremony to be held in Japan, but also the Pokémon World Championship this Summer (complete with round-trip economy class ticket and accomodation near the venues)
  • Runner-up: $2 000 + invite to the award ceremony to be held in Japan, but also the Pokémon World Championship this Summer (complete with round-trip economy class ticket and accomodation near the venues)
  • Third place: $1 000 + invite to the award ceremony to be held in Japan, but also the Pokémon World Championship this Summer (complete with round-trip economy class ticket and accomodation near the venues)
  • Other prizes: $500

This year, the special judges are Tsunekazu Ishihara (president of The Pokémon Company), Ken Sugimori (from Game Freak), and Nigo.

Pokémon GO

The latest Community Day took place on Sunday, and it featured Beldum. Unfortunately, the event suffered from major issues in Asia. To apologise for this, Niantic has announced that an additional Community Day featuring Beldum would be held at a later date, though only for that region. More details will be shared soon.
